`
linleizi
  • 浏览: 230663 次
  • 性别: Icon_minigender_1
  • 来自: 大连
社区版块
存档分类
最新评论

JS控制HTML页面控件的属性

阅读更多
checkbox控件:
下面例子用到的css属性
.fieldColor {
font-family: "MS UI Gothic";
font-size: 12px;
height: 17px;
border: 1px solid #ADD566;
background-color: #DFDFDF;
text-readonly: true;
}
// 选中checkbox
document.all.testCheckbox.checked = true;
// checkbox不可用
document.all.testCheckbox.disabled = true;
<input type="checkbox" name="testCheckbox" />

// 获得文本框的值
document.all.testText.value;
// 文本框只读
document.all.testText.readOnly = true;
// 文本框不可用
document.all.testText.disabled = true;
// 文本框的class属性
document.all.testText.className = "fieldColor ";
<input type="text" name="testText" />

// div是否显示
document.getElementById("testDiv").display = "none";//block
// div居高
document.getElementById("testDiv").style.top = 1750;
<div id="testDiv"></div>

// 列中插入值
document.getElementById("testTd").innerText = "练习向<td></td>间插入值";
<td id="testTd"></td>

// lable的背景色
document.getElementById("testLabel").style.backgroundColor = "red";
// lable设置值
document.getElementById("testLabel").innerHTML = "<label></label>中间设值";
<label id="testLabel"></label>

// form的action属性
document.testForm.action = url;
// form提交属性
document.testForm.submit();
<form name="testForm" method="post"></form>

// 获得表格的行数
document.getElementById("testTable").rows.length;
// 设置表的高度
document.getElementById("testTable").style.height = "20px";
<table id="testTable"><tr><td></td></tr></table>
分享到:
评论

相关推荐

    JS控制html控件.rar

    在"JS控制html控件"的主题中,我们将深入探讨JavaScript如何操纵HTML元素,为网页添加互动性。 1. DOM(文档对象模型):DOM是HTML和XML文档的编程接口,JavaScript通过DOM可以访问和修改HTML元素。例如,通过`...

    Javascript密码输入控件

    JavaScript密码输入控件是网页开发中常见的一种交互元素,它用于收集用户的安全信息,如登录密码、PIN码等。在Web应用中,正确地实现密码输入控件对于提高用户体验和保障数据安全至关重要。本文将深入探讨JavaScript...

    jquery经典案列,获取控件属性并改变。

    总结起来,jQuery提供了一系列方便的方法,如`.val()`, `.prop()`, `.css()`, `.html()`, 和`.on()`,使得获取和改变网页控件的属性变得简单。通过熟练掌握这些方法,开发者可以轻松实现各种用户交互效果,提高网页...

    JS控件,JAVASCRIPT控件,实用控件!

    JavaScript控件的核心在于通过JavaScript代码操作HTML元素,实现对网页内容的动态控制。这通常涉及DOM(Document Object Model)操作,通过改变DOM节点的属性、样式或内容来更新页面视图。此外,事件监听也是关键,...

    js生成和删除控件.doc

    例如,可以为下拉列表添加`onchange`事件,当用户选择特定值时,通过修改其他隐藏控件的`style.display`属性来控制其可见性。 对于动态添加文件输入控件的场景,`addFile()` 函数展示了如何在页面上动态创建一个...

    ASP.NET\ASP.NET服务端控件,HTML控件,HTML服务端控件 的区别

    通过在HTML元素上添加`runat="server"`属性,可以将其提升为服务端控件,允许在服务器端代码中引用和控制。然而,与ASP.NET服务端控件相比,HTML服务端控件的功能较为有限。 ##### 特点: - **半服务端**:虽然它们...

    web服务器控件与html服务器控件的区别及用法

    - **何时使用HTML服务器控件**:如果需要更精细地控制HTML输出,或者页面设计要求严格的HTML标准遵循性时,可以选择使用HTML服务器控件。此外,当希望减少服务器负载或提高页面响应速度时,HTML服务器控件也是更好的...

    JS显示隐藏HTML控件

    在HTML页面中,我们有时需要动态地控制某些元素的可见性,比如按钮、文本框等控件。这就是"JS显示隐藏HTML控件"这一主题所涉及的核心内容。通过JavaScript,我们可以实现对HTML元素的显示和隐藏,以提升用户体验和...

    JS时间控件,JS时间控件

    在网页开发中,JavaScript(JS)时间控件是一种常见的交互元素,它允许用户方便地选择日期和时间。这种控件通常用于表单填写、事件安排或任何需要用户输入时间信息的场景。本压缩包包含了一个JS时间控件的实现,包括...

    js日期时间控件 JavaScriptjs日期时间控件 jsp

    JavaScript日期时间控件是网页开发中常用的一种组件,主要用于用户在网页上选择或输入日期和时间。在JavaScript中,处理日期和时间的核心对象是`Date`。本篇将深入探讨JavaScript日期时间控件的实现原理、使用方法...

    HTML调用OCX控件

    - `width`和`height`属性用于设置控件在页面上的尺寸。 2. `&lt;embed&gt;`标签: `控件CLSID" width="宽度" height="高度"&gt;&lt;/embed&gt;` - `type`属性设定为`application/x-oleobject`,表示这是一个ActiveX控件。 - ...

    WebCalendar网页日历控件(js,javascript)

    WebCalendar是一款基于JavaScript的网页日历控件,它允许用户在网页上方便地选择和操作日期,极大地提升了用户在网页上的交互体验。这个控件主要适用于那些需要在网页上进行日期输入或者事件管理的应用,例如在线...

    javascript控件开发之页面控制器

    在本主题"JavaScript控件开发之页面控制器"中,我们将深入探讨如何利用JavaScript来实现对网页的控制,特别是页面控制器的实现。页面控制器通常用于管理页面的导航、数据加载以及用户交互逻辑,它是构建大型单页应用...

    javascript控件开发之可见控件(2)

    总的来说,“javascript控件开发之可见控件(2)”的主题涵盖了JavaScript控件的核心知识点,包括DOM操作、事件处理、函数的可重用性和继承,以及如何通过控制显示属性来实现控件的可见性切换。这些都是构建高效、灵活...

    通过HTML调用OCX控件

    在HTML页面中,按照上述方式插入控件,并通过JavaScript或VBScript与之交互,调用其公开的方法和属性。 总的来说,通过HTML调用OCX控件是一种扩展Web应用功能的方法,尽管现代Web开发更倾向于使用Web API和...

    js获取页面控件坐标.pdf

    JS 获取页面控件坐标 在 HTML 文档中,获取页面控件坐标是非常重要的,特别是在进行交互式开发时。今天,我们将讨论如何使用 JavaScript 获取页面控件坐标。 在 HTML 文档中,每个元素都有其自己的坐标系,通过...

    JS动态添加控件

    JavaScript(简称JS)是一种轻量级的脚本语言,广泛应用于网页和网络应用开发,能够对网页中的元素进行操作和交互。动态添加控件是JS的一个核心能力,它允许开发者在用户交互过程中或者程序运行时根据需要动态创建或...

    winform html 编辑控件

    - **ZetaHtmlEditControl**:这可能是另一个HTML编辑控件,可能提供了更高级的功能,如HTML5支持、CSS样式控制、JavaScript交互等。它可能提供了一个API,使得开发者可以方便地在C#代码中调用和控制编辑器的行为。 ...

    pb11.5 嵌入ole控件web browser 通过html页面打开窗口

    总的来说,PB11.5中的OLE Web Browser控件为开发者提供了一种集成网页内容的方式,并且可以通过HTML页面的链接控制应用程序的行为。通过深入理解和实践,你可以创建出更丰富的用户界面,提高应用的交互性。

    javascript控件开发之布局控件

    JavaScript控件开发是Web开发中的重要一环,特别是在构建交互丰富的网页应用时。布局控件是其中的关键元素,它允许开发者有效地组织和管理页面上的元素,实现多控件的协调和共存。在这个主题中,我们将深入探讨...

Global site tag (gtag.js) - Google Analytics